Manage File Station Options
To manage File Station settings, open File Station and click the Settings button.
General
Here you can enable File Station logs to record the activities of all users. The user activities include Create folder, Upload, Download, Delete, Rename, Move, Copy and Property set.
To enable File Station log:
- If you want to record the activities of all users, tick Enable File Station log.
- Click OK.
To see the File Station log:
- Click View Logs, which will lead you to Log Center.
- Click File Transfer tab.
To automatically overwrite files with drag-and-drop uploading or keyboard shortcuts:
Tick Always overwrite files when I drag and drop them onto Web browser or paste with keyboard shortcuts if you want to automatically overwrite files with the same name when dragging and dropping files from your computer desktop onto web browser, or pasting files with keyboard shortcuts within File Station.
To browse and manage files from the local computer with File Station:
- Tick Browse files from the local computer with File Station.
- Click OK.
Shared Links
By default, all users can share file links. Here you can limit the access to shared links management to administrators only.
To determine who can share file links:
- Choose All users, Administrators, or Specific users.
- Click OK.
To open HTML files as plain text:
- Tick the box Always open HTML files using plain text format. If this option is enabled, HTML files (i.e. HTM, HTML, JSP, XHTML files) are displayed using plain text format when users open them via a file sharing link. This option helps prevent malicious parties from hijacking user login sessions by using embedded script in HTML files.
- Click OK.
Speed Limit
You can enable a speed limit to control the maximum usable bandwidth for users who transfer data via File Station.
To enable speed limit:
- Tick the box marked Enable speed limit, or Enable speed limit according to a schedule if you would like to implement a speed limit at specific times only. This is a server-wide setting and will override the settings of individual users. Choosing No speed limit disables the speed limit settings of all users.
- Click Speed Limit Settings to modify the settings for individual users. For each user, you can select one of the following:
- No speed limit: No speed limit will be applied when users transfer files with the service.
- Constant: A fixed, constant speed limit will be applied to the user. Upload and download speed limits can be specified in the fields to the left.
- Variable: Two different speed limits can be specified and applied to the user according to a schedule. Click the Customize button to modify the speed limit settings and set a schedule.
- Click Apply.
Security
Here you can find the below security settings.
To open HTML files as plain text:
- Tick the box Always open HTML files using plain text format. If this option is enabled, HTML files (i.e. HTM, HTML, JSP, XHTML files) are displayed using plain text format when opened in File Station. This option helps prevent malicious parties from hijacking user login sessions by using embedded script in HTML files.
- This is not a global setting. Each user can choose whether or not to enabled this option according to his individual needs.
- Click OK.
